#284d6c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#284d6c is composed of 15.7% red, 30.2%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63% cyan, 28.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 207.4 degrees, a saturation of 45.9% and a lightness of 29%. #284d6c color hex could be obtained by blending #509ad8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#284d6c color description : Very dark blue.

#284d6c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#284d6c has RGB values of R:40, G:77,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 2641260.

Shades and Tints of #284d6c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030608 is the darkest color, while #f8f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#284d6c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444a50 is the less saturated color, while #005194 is the most saturated one.
